Molly G. Hardie, MD ’00, has been elected to the Board of Trustees of the Thomas Jefferson Foundation, the private, nonprofit organization that owns and operates Monticello.

Hardie is co-chair of H7 Holdings, LLC, a private family investment company that owns and manages Keswick Hall and Golf Club in Keswick, Virginia; the Jefferson Hotel in Richmond, Virginia; and the Hermitage Hotel in Nashville, Tennessee. She has served on numerous local boards, including the UVA Health Foundation Board and the Virginia Discovery Museum Board. She was an active member of the Young Families Committee for the Children’s Medical Center and the Children’s Medical Center/Children’s Hospital Committee at the University of Virginia.
